MUSEUM LAUNCHES WORLD WAR II ORAL HISTORY PROGRAM


NEWS RELEASE


ATTENTION WORLD WAR II VETERANS:
Your service experiences are needed for present and future generations. World War Two veterans, from all branches of Service are invited to register for oral history interviews. The California Military Museum, Sacramento; in conjunction with the University of California, Los Angeles and the California State University, Los Angeles; have established the California Military History Educational Project The Museum has been tasked to develop military history educational curriculum materials to supplement the history instruction at all California elementary, intermediate and high schools. Part of this is to develop a database of World War 2 veterans for oral history interviews. if you register you will not be required to do anything but tell us something of your recollections. This will be a chance to tell your history, to help preserve the memories of experiences. Your story is important and we would like to interview you, at a time and place convenient to you. The interview will be archived at the museum and you will be provided with a free copy of the interview for your and your families, use.
